Position Title:
Company Security Officer (Canada)

Location: Ottawa, ON

Clearance Required: Secret with ability to obtain Top Secret

Reports To: U.S. Facility Security Officer, Compliance & Data Protection

Position Summary

The Company Security Officer (Canada) & Director, Legal & Compliance is responsible for ensuring organizational compliance with all Canadian federal contract requirements, security regulations, and industrial security obligations. This role oversees various internal compliance programs, supports government contracting activities, and leads all aspects of the Public Services and Procurement Canada (PSPC) Contract Security Program (CSP).

The position ensures that the organization meets its obligations under the Policy on Government Security
, Security of Information Act
, and other federal directives related to the protection of sensitive or classified information and assets.

Industrial Security Leadership (Canada)
  • Serve as Gartner’s Company Security Officer (CSO) in Canada under the PSPC Contract Security Program.
  • Manage all requirements related to:
  • Designated Organization Screening (DOS)
  • Facility Security Clearance (FSC)
  • Personnel Screening (Reliability, Secret, Top Secret)
  • Safeguarding requirements for classified information and assets
  • Maintain accurate records in the Online Industrial Security System (OLISS).
  • Oversee secure facility zones, access controls, and protection of hard-copy and electronic classified information.
  • Ensure compliance with the Government of Canada Standard on Security Screening and departmental directives.
